Tour Highlights

Incredible Wildlife Encounters

The Masai Mara is home to a stunning variety of wildlife, including elephants, lions, leopards, buffalo, rhinos, cheetahs, hyenas, giraffes, and a wide array of antelope species. Game drives offer excellent opportunities for photography and close-up encounters with animals in the wild.

The Great Wildebeest Migration (Seasonal)

From July to October, witness one of the greatest natural spectacles on Earth—the Great Migration, when over two million wildebeest, zebras, and gazelles cross the Mara River in search of greener pastures. The drama of river crossings and predator-prey interactions makes this a bucket-list experience.

Scenic Landscapes

Enjoy sweeping views of rolling savannahs, acacia-dotted plains, and winding rivers, all under the vast African sky. The Mara’s beauty is as compelling as its wildlife, especially at sunrise and sunset.

Bush Breakfast & Off-the-Beaten-Path Adventures

On Day 3, delight in a bush breakfast after an early game drive—a truly immersive experience that allows you to dine amidst the wilderness.

Cultural Experience with the Maasai People

Discover the rich traditions and lifestyle of the Maasai community. Learn about their age-old customs, dances, homesteads (manyattas), and dress, offering a deeper understanding of Kenya’s cultural heritage.

Your Itinerary

Day 1: Journey to the Masai Mara – Scenic Drive through the Rift Valley

After a hearty breakfast in Nairobi, your journey begins as you depart the bustling city and head westward. Drive through the Great Rift Valley, where scenic viewpoints allow you to marvel at the vast escarpments and volcanic hills. Along the way, you'll pass through Narok, a vibrant Maasai town, before entering the majestic Masai Mara National Reserve by early afternoon.

Upon arrival, check in at your lodge and enjoy a delicious lunch. After some rest, head out for your first afternoon game drive, offering a taste of what awaits over the next few days—lion prides lazing under trees, herds of elephants roaming, and giraffes nibbling on treetops. Return to the lodge for dinner and a relaxing evening in the African wilderness.

Accommodation: Mara Sopa Lodge / Sarova Mara
Meal Plan: Lunch & Dinner (Full Board)

Day 2: Full Day Game Drives in the Masai Mara

Today is dedicated to exploring the wonders of the Masai Mara. Set out early for a morning game drive, when animals are most active. Traverse the vast savannah in search of Africa’s Big Five and many other species that thrive here.

Return to the lodge for breakfast and enjoy some time at leisure. In the afternoon, embark on another game drive to explore a different section of the reserve. If visiting between July and October, you may witness the awe-inspiring wildebeest migration as they cross the Mara River in dramatic scenes often targeted by crocodiles and big cats.

The diversity and density of wildlife in the Masai Mara is unmatched—keep your camera ready! After sunset, return to the lodge for dinner and storytelling under the stars.

Accommodation: Mara Sopa Lodge / Sarova Mara
Meal Plan: Full Board

Day 3: Sunrise Game Drive, Bush Breakfast & Maasai Cultural Visit

Begin your day with a sunrise game drive, a magical time when the bush comes alive. As the golden rays light up the savannah, observe predators returning from a night hunt and herbivores beginning their day. After an exciting morning drive, enjoy a bush breakfast served in a scenic spot within the reserve—an unforgettable moment in the wild.

Later, return to the lodge to relax. In the afternoon, choose between an optional visit to a Maasai village, where you'll interact with locals, see traditional homes, and learn about their customs, or enjoy another short game drive to catch any animals you may have missed.

Accommodation: Mara Sopa Lodge / Sarova Mara
Meal Plan: Full Board

Day 4: Return to Nairobi – Safari Farewell

After breakfast, it’s time to bid farewell to the Masai Mara. Enjoy your final views of the wilderness as you depart the reserve and drive back to Nairobi. You’ll arrive in the city by late afternoon, in time for your evening flight or further travel plans.

Meal Plan: Breakfast & Lunch
